Python 求助大牛,pyinstaller 打包 pytest+allure 自动化测试框架后运行报错,请大牛指教

oscarforever · 2020年06月22日 · 1448 次阅读

问题描述:在源程序中运行 pytest.main(['.\ApiTestCase', '--alluredir=\ApiTestReport', '--clean-alluredir']) 可以正常执行,在使用 pyinstaller -F Auto_Runner_Api_Main.py 生成的
Auto_Runner_Api_Main.exe 程序执行时报如下错误:
ERROR: usage: Auto_Runner_Api_Main.exe [options] [file_or_dir] [file_or_dir] [...]
Auto_Runner_Api_Main.exe: error: unrecognized arguments: --alluredir=\ApiTestReport --clean-alluredir
inifile: None
rootdir: C:\Users\oscar\eclipse-workspace\AutoRunner_ApiPlatform\src\dist
注:本机已按装 allure-pytest 插件,是没有将 allure-pytest 插件打包进去吗?请大牛指点,多谢啦!
.

暂无回复。
需要 登录 后方可回复, 如果你还没有账号请点击这里 注册